Lady Titans shutout Tupelo, 2-0

January 20, 2009
Ridgeland High School



The Lady Titans faced a true test just days before the District 4-4A playoff spots would be settled. The Lady Waves from Tupelo travelled down to Jackson to face Clinton, Madison Central and Ridgeland.

After suffering 3-1 losses to both Clinton and Madison Central, the Lady Wave hoped to come away with a win. They did not.

The defense that has allowed only two goals in January, allowed absolutely none to the visitors from Tupelo. “The defense has experienced a bit of a resurgence these last few games,” said Coach Winship. “Our defense has gone mostly unnoticed this year as we have had trouble scoring, but they have quietly gone about their business.”

The team has allowed thirteen goals in seventeen matches for a goals against average of just 0.68.

The first Titan score came off a failure to clear a ball driven to the Tupelo keeper. Her pass was deflected by 8th grade forward Mary Ashton Lembo to a wide-open Carmen Bofill. The junior laced a shot into the net for the 1-0 lead.

The second goal came off a steal by freshman midfielder Rachel Harris. Her pass to senior midfielder Morgan Webb was sent into space to Bofill. Her cut and shot gave the Lady Titans the 2-0 lead.

The defense led by junior fullback Allison Ayers and junior keeper CJ Winship would allow Tupelo only four quality shots on goal.

The district playoff race will be decided Tuesday at Titan Field.
